Hi Pedro,

The macro substitution doesn't work in reports. You'll have to either hack FRX and replace format there before printing report or use TRANSFORM() function in a report field.

>Hi
>
>In my report , in field quantity , i define format = 9 999 999.999
>
>But i want the user to be able to define the size of decimal places in the
>quantity in report .
>
>So i have a parameter , and i build a public variable , then my public variable is equal for example a "9 999 999.9" .
>
>Now , how can i put in format in report my public variable ?
>
>I have tried with "=" and "&" , but don´t work .
>
>Can you help me ?
>
>Thanks
